Rocktober and some fall fishing action

 

Bow River brown trout fishingFall fishing is in full swing and the leaves have all morphed from green to golden yellows and maroon red. The water temperatures have cooled down but the fishing action is just getting warmed up. The last couple of guided fishing trips have been very successful, with my clients landing fourteen rainbows and one brown last Saturday. Sunday October the 14th was even more successful, with twenty incredible fish landed including two browns, which happened to be a first for my clients Carla and her son Caylen. It was a great day for fishing the Bow River!
